Colombia 1877 10 Centavos Brown (Counterfeit)

Colombia · 1877 · 10 centavos

This stamp features the Colombian coat of arms, depicting a condor above a shield flanked by cornucopias and a Phrygian cap. Inscriptions include 'COLOMBIA', 'CORREOS NACIONALES', and 'DIEZ CENTAVOS'.

This 10 centavos definitive issue from Colombia is a known counterfeit, identified by its bogus 'BOGOTA' cancellation. It highlights the challenges of postal security and the prevalence of forgeries in the 19th century.
